Rover Way energy park and data centre, Splott

Cardiff, WalesApprovedData centreCapacity not published Verified — 2 sources on file

Cardiff Council granted full planning permission on 15 April 2025 for the partial removal of fill material, reprofiling groundworks and the installation of an energy park comprising a battery energy storage facility, associated substation and ancillary buildings, together with a data centre, on land at Rover Way, Splott. The Planning Committee resolved to grant on 17 October 2024 subject to a Section 106 agreement, and the decision was issued once that agreement was completed. The register does not state an electrical capacity for the data centre, so none is recorded.

Power
No data centre IT load, electrical demand or grid connection capacity has been published for this scheme. The 1,000 MW figure widely reported for this site is the capacity of the battery energy storage facility within the wider energy park, not the power capacity of the data centre.
